Window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ows to improve the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. This work typically includes removing old or damaged windows, preparing the opening, and carefully installing new units to ensure a proper fit and seal. Skilled contractors may also offer custom window options to match the style and architectural details of a home or commercial building, helping to enhance curb appeal and overall property value.
These services are often sought after to address common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, or visible damage like cracks and warping. Upgrading windows can help reduce energy costs by preventing heat loss during colder months and keeping interiors cooler when it’s warm outside. Additionally, new windows can improve noise insulation and provide better security, making a property more comfortable and safe for its occupants.

The overview below groups typical Window Installation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Dutchess County, NY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window repairs, such as replacing a broken pane or sealing leaks, generally range from $100 to $300. Many routine repairs fall within this lower to mid-range, depending on the scope of work and window type.
Standard Replacements - Full window replacements for standard-sized units usually cost between $250 and $600 per window. Most projects in this category are priced within this range, with fewer jobs reaching higher costs due to additional customization or materials.
Large or Complex Installations - Larger or more intricate window installation projects, including custom designs or multi-window setups, can range from $1,000 to $3,000 or more per window. Such projects are less common but are typical for high-end or specialized windows.
Whole-Home Window Replacement - Replacing all windows in a home can typically cost between $10,000 and $30,000, depending on the number of windows and their size. Many homes fall into the middle of this range, with larger or premium options pushing costs higher.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
